JUDGMENT
Dated this the 25th day of March, 2021 This appeal is filed by the petitioner in O.P.
(MV).No.1140/2012 on the file of the Motor Accidents Claims Tribunal, Irinjalakkuda. The claim petition was filed by him seeking compensation for the injuries sustained on account of the accident occurred on 28.08.2012. According to him he was a carpenter aged 43 years with a monthly income of Rs.20,000/-. It was contended that on account of the injuries, he sustained permanent disablement, which affected his earning capacity. As compensation, he claimed a amount of Rs.1,50,000/-.
2. The 2nd respondent Insurance Company alone contested the case. They filed written statement admitting the coverage of policy in respect of the vehicle involved, but disputed the liability on various grounds. Quantum of compensation sought for by the appellant was also seriously disputed. the evidence in this case consists of Exts.A1 to A11 and oral evidence of PW1, from the side of the petitioner. The Insurance certificate was produced as Ext.B1 from the side of the respondents. After the trial, the Tribunal passed an award allowing a total compensation of Rs.45,385/-.
